Bomb Attack On CPM Office In Coinbatore

17 Jun, 2017 14:15 IST|Sakshi
The CPI(M) blamed ‘Hindutva’ activists for the attack

Unidentified persons hurled a petrol bomb at the district CPI(M) office in Coimbatore early on Saturday, prompting condemnation from opposition parties in the state. Though nobody was injured in the incident, a car parked there was partially damaged.

The CPI(M) blamed 'Hindutva' activists for the attack and claimed it was a "continuation" of the recent attempt to attack party General Secretary Sitaram Yechury in Delhi.

DMK Working President and Tamil Nadu Opposition Leader M K Stalin strongly condemned the attack on the Left party's office. He alleged "evil forces" were trying to resort to violence and affect law and order in the state and urged the state government to bring the culprits to the book.
